| posted: 12/1/2003 at 10:22:36 AM ET Interestinly enough I just read an article on her that addressed these very issues. Though I can't remember where. I guess it wasn't really recently but a couple of months ago. It might have been an old article I was reading again. Anyway, sorry for the tangent.
Bernadette does not consider herself a dancer. She said she "moves well" but is not a dancer. Also if I remember correctly she considers herself an actor who can sing. And since she spends most of her time acting as opposed to dancing or recording albums then I guess she practices what she believes. Though I agree, she seems like a great dancer -at least she was when she was younger - and a tremendous stand alone singer.
